fuzzing的音標為["f?z??],基本翻譯為“模糊測試”或“混淆測試”,通常用于軟件測試中,以發(fā)現(xiàn)潛在的錯誤或漏洞。
對于速記技巧,這里有一些建議:
1. 理解并使用音節(jié)劃分:這是速記的基礎(chǔ),可以幫助你更好地記住單詞的發(fā)音和拼寫。
2. 練習和重復(fù):速記需要大量的練習和重復(fù),只有通過不斷的實踐,你才能更好地掌握速記技巧。
3. 使用記憶技巧:你可以使用各種記憶技巧,如聯(lián)想、圖像化、口訣等,來幫助你記住單詞的速記。
4. 結(jié)合其他學習策略:除了速記技巧,你還可以結(jié)合其他學習策略,如聽力訓練、閱讀理解、詞匯練習等,以提高你的速記能力。
希望這些建議對你有所幫助!
Fuzzing這個詞的英文詞源可以追溯到英語中的“fuzz”一詞,意為模糊或混亂。它的變化形式包括復(fù)數(shù)形式“fuzzes”和過去式、過去分詞形式“fuzzed”以及現(xiàn)在分詞形式“fuzzing”。
相關(guān)單詞:
1. Fuzzball:通常指模糊不清或難以理解的事物,也可以指某個領(lǐng)域或?qū)W科的新手或初學者。
2. Fuzziness:意為模糊不清、不明確的狀態(tài)或性質(zhì),通常用來描述概念、想法或事物的不清晰或不明確。
3. Fuzzification:意為將模糊不清的事物變得清晰明確的過程或方法。
4. Fuzz-out:通常指在測試過程中,通過制造模糊的數(shù)據(jù)或輸入來觸發(fā)系統(tǒng)中的錯誤或異常行為。
5. Fuzz-test:一種測試方法,通過制造模糊的數(shù)據(jù)或輸入來測試系統(tǒng)的健壯性和安全性。
舉例來說,在網(wǎng)絡(luò)安全領(lǐng)域,fuzzing通常指的是通過生成隨機或異常的數(shù)據(jù)輸入來測試系統(tǒng)的健壯性。這種方法可以發(fā)現(xiàn)潛在的漏洞和錯誤,有助于提高系統(tǒng)的安全性。同時,fuzzing也常被用于軟件測試中,以發(fā)現(xiàn)潛在的缺陷和錯誤。
常用短語:
1. fuzz testing
2. fuzzing tool
3. fuzzing algorithm
4. fuzzing attack
5. fuzzing framework
6. fuzzing engine
7. fuzzing protocol
雙語例句:
1. Fuzzing is a technique used to test the robustness of software by systematically sending random inputs to it.
2. A fuzzing tool is a software program that uses a fuzzing algorithm to identify potential vulnerabilities in a software application.
3. Fuzzing is an effective way to discover hidden vulnerabilities in a system without requiring any manual intervention.
4. By using a fuzzing framework, developers can automate the process of fuzzing and reduce the time required for testing.
5. Fuzzing engines are powerful tools that can scan large amounts of code quickly and efficiently.
6. Fuzzing protocols allow for the exchange of random inputs between a fuzzer and a target system, enabling effective testing of complex software systems.
英文小作文:
Fuzzing is a powerful technique that can be used to test the robustness of software systems. By systematically sending random inputs to a software application, fuzzing can help identify potential vulnerabilities that may exist in the code. This technique is particularly useful for finding hidden vulnerabilities in complex software systems that may otherwise be difficult to detect using traditional testing methods.
One of the benefits of fuzzing is its automation capabilities. Fuzzing tools and frameworks can be easily set up and run automatically, reducing the time and effort required for testing. This allows developers to focus on other aspects of the development process, such as bug fixing and code optimization, while still ensuring that the software is secure.
Another advantage of fuzzing is its effectiveness in finding vulnerabilities that may not be immediately apparent to the human eye. By using a fuzzing engine, it is possible to scan large amounts of code quickly and efficiently, identifying potential issues even in complex software systems that may have been missed by manual testing methods.
Overall, fuzzing is a valuable tool in the arsenal of modern software developers and security professionals. By using fuzzing techniques, it is possible to ensure that software systems are secure and robust, reducing the risk of data breaches and other security incidents.
名師輔導(dǎo)
環(huán)球網(wǎng)校
建工網(wǎng)校
會計網(wǎng)校
新東方
醫(yī)學教育
中小學學歷